Mark 9:14-29 The plea of a desperate father

Any parent whose child is sick – very sick and for a long time, knows exactly how the father in this passage feels. Imagine seeing your child thrown in fire or in water since childhood! vv.21-22

The father said to Jesus: “But if you can do anything, take pity on us and help us.” BUT is the big connecting word. He knew that his son was very sick and seems hopeless.. BUT if Jesus can do ‘anything’ (anything at all). Secondly, he asked Jesus to ‘take pity’ – ‘Maawa na po kayo sa amin!’ Please help us.
Thirdly, the father is willing to believe that a miracle can happen. And even then, his last plea is for Jesus to help him in his unbelief! v.24

What a discerning/humble father! He so much wanted for his son to get healed – he pleaded with Jesus to have compassion/pity on them. He asked Jesus to do anything he can. He also asked Jesus to add to his faith – knowing it might be lacking.

Even faith is a gift/grace from God. To be able to believe – to trust that God is too wise to be mistaken and too good to be unkind, this firm confidence, we should ask God to give to us.

I do believe! Help me overcome my unbelief! When I do, then there is nothing in life that is too difficult to bear or to overcome.
